Given f(x)=x+5 all over 3, solve for f^-1(3)

Think of f(x) as y(x) and inverse function as x(y).
[tex]f^{-1} (3) = x(3)[/tex]
So y = 3, solve for x

[tex]f(x) = y = \frac{x+5}{3} \\ \\ \frac{x+5}{3} = 3 \\ \\ x+5 = 9 \\ \\ x = 4[/tex]

Therefore,
[tex]f^{-1} (3) = 4[/tex]
